The yukata (浴衣) is a casual version of the kimono. Far lighter (in terms of material), more casual, and versatile; their role sits somewhere between breezy summer dress, kimono, and robe. If you want to do this the 100% traditional, authentic way, you need ALL of the following items to wear a yukata: the yukata itself, a kimono slip (not to be confused with a juban -- the slip is cotton and looks like a short-sleeved wrap-around dress), two ties to hold everything together, a hanhaba obi, and a pair of geta. When going out in yukata, you should wear Japanese traditional footwear such as geta (wooden clogs), zori (Japanese sandals) or setta (leather-soled sandals). The yukata was originally used as house loungewear, or a bathrobe that many people wore to the public bath, or the Onsen.
